Output ec391baa2fa8a2ea172841577cccf8ecbd97117223e6ce5d8a68e730f44ed8cd:0

value
1058
script pubkey
OP_0 OP_PUSHBYTES_20 e240c90dd1bbad95d37dad390775fff1b6f6707a
address
bc1qufqvjrw3hwket5ma45uswa0l7xm0vur6unra8j
transaction
ec391baa2fa8a2ea172841577cccf8ecbd97117223e6ce5d8a68e730f44ed8cd
spent
true